Foot Institute Doctors put in about a decade in learning, the first 4 years in undergraduate studies to acquire a Bachelors Degree, and the 2nd four years in Medical School to acquire a Podiatric Medical Degree. Podiatric Medical School is similar to typical medical school and in fact quite a number podiatry training programs are contained inside these schools. After receiving a Podiatric Medial Degree, Podiatrists at the Foot Institute complete a hospital "internship" or post degree residency for yet another 1 to 3 years.
At the conclusion of the internship or residency, our Podiatric physicians have obtained significant medical education with an emphasis on conditions concerning the feet and ankles. They are skilled to treat concerns stretching from standard ailments for instance, ingrown and fungal toe nails, to those which are more sophisticated for instance, clubfoot, bunions, or reconstructive surgery of the foot. Our physicians have comprehensive surgical instruction which provide them the expertise necessary to perform surgery on those concerns that are best managed through surgical intervention.
Doctors at the Foot Institute furthermore have a comprehensive practical knowledge and understanding of biomechanics, which is the study of the forces which the feet and legs receive as we walk, run or perform other activities. Realizing biomechanics and gait peculiarities allows a Podiatrist to develop shoes and orthotics which can give pain relief and reduce the chances of numerous problems which the feet normally experience.
